413th FTG greets first-ever honorary CC

Community leader becomes honorary commander

Col. Brian Moore, left, 78th Air Base Wing commander, and Col. Sean Bittner, 413th Flight Test Group commander, present an induction certificate to Emerson Fromm, Mid State Pools & Spas co-owner, during an honorary commander induction ceremony Oct. 1, 2020, at Robins Air Force Base, Georgia. Robins AFB’s honorary commander program was designed to provide community leaders exposure to the base’s mission, while building stronger relationships the installation and the Middle Georgia area. This was the 413th FTG’s first time participating in the program. (U.S. Air Force photo by Jamal D. Sutter)
